Real-World Considerations for Holiday Production

While Letter R in Beautiful Flower is described as “fun and easy to stitch,” its beauty lies in detail—and detail demands intention. Here’s what I watched for during test stitching:

  1. Hoop size & stitch density: The floral elements extend beyond a compact letter shape. Don’t force it into a 3x3” hoop unless confirmed by the file specs. A 4x4” or larger hoop gives breathing room for petals to settle without distortion.
  2. Fabric texture matters: On thick kitchen towels or dense sweatshirts, use medium-weight cutaway stabilizer—not tear-away—to prevent puckering in the vine areas. For stretchy garments (like ribbed knits), add light fusible backing first.
  3. Thread colors make or break the mood: On dark fabric, avoid stark white—try ivory, antique gold, or dusty rose instead. On light fabric, test pastel pinks or sage greens to keep it soft, not clinical. Metallic thread? Use sparingly—only on outer petals, not stems—unless your machine handles dense metallics reliably.
  4. Small details need verification: After stitching, check that inner vine loops remain open and unstitched-over. Dense fill areas (like the flower center) can flatten if stitch density is too high—review the embroidery file’s layering before mass production.
